多指标聚合
为了展示全部资源,这里我使用了
ended_at=null
作为搜索条件,你也可以根据实际情况更换。
资源占用 Top N
{
"operations": "(metric 指标 mean)",
"resource_type": "资源类型",
"search": "ended_at=null"
}
多指标平均值
{
"operations": "(aggregate mean (metric 指标 mean))",
"resource_type": "资源类型",
"search": "ended_at=null"
}
双指标利用率
{
"operations": [
"aggregate",
"mean",
[
"/",
[
"metric",
"占用指标,如 used",
"mean"
],
[
"metric",
"总指标,如 total",
"mean"
]
]
],
"resource_type": "资源类型",
"search": "ended_at=null"
}
单指标运算
利用率:CPU、内存等
该算法主要利用了 rate:mean 聚合方式完成,所以在 Measurements 指明为 Cumulative 的指标均可以使用该算法。
{
"operations": "(* (/ (aggregate rate:mean (metric ${指标UUID} mean)) ${采样间隔:纳秒}) 100)"
}